The Gap Between the Policy’s Intent and Its Effect
The FCC’s July 2026 rule blocks new equipment certifications for foreign-made mobile robots, including humanoids and quadrupeds, on national security grounds. The instinct is to read that as a straightforward win for US builders and the humanoid category generally. The reason it isn’t is what the rule can’t reach: the motors, actuators, batteries, and rare earth materials inside every unit, most of which still trace back to China regardless of where final assembly happens.
That’s the gap operations leaders now have to plan around. A trade rule can restrict where a robot is assembled. It can’t, on its own, restrict where the components inside it come from. Treating a “Made in America” label as a supply chain risk mitigant is the mistake this restriction quietly exposes.

How IDC Research Supports Panelists’ Perspectives
A leader at a robotics component supplier argued the rule serves a dual purpose: a national security measure today, and an incentive for domestic production tomorrow. IDC’s own research on Americas manufacturing (IDC #US53528026) confirms reshoring is real and accelerating. Still, the same research is candid about the gap between incentive and outcome: workforce shortages, hidden transition costs, and business cases that are “often more fragile than anticipated” are the actual execution risk, not the policy intent.
A leader at a robotics hardware and optics firm argued that trust, security, and long-term vendor support must come before country of assembly for enterprise buyers evaluating humanoid robots for critical operations. IDC’s own vendor assessment of autonomous mobile robots (IDC #US53016726) points in the same direction, independently advising buyers to weight vendor stability and multi-year service roadmaps over hardware price.
A third panelist called the rule “a sensible first step,” designed carefully enough that US companies could keep sourcing the best global sensors, motors, and computing while domestic supply grows around them. IDC’s own supply chain research (IDC #US50873823) points to a different outcome: what gets called “made in America” is usually “assembled in America,” with parts still coming from overseas, and IDC expects nearshoring activity to concentrate on final assembly rather than components for the foreseeable future.

The Actual Takeaway
IDC’s own framing in Forbes says it more sharply: the market isn’t simply helped or hurt by this rule; it’s splitting into two tracks: mass-market categories that keep growing regardless, and higher-value categories where “the appearance of protection outpaces the reality of supply chain independence.” For a physical AI investment case, the practical version of that split comes down to one unresolved variable: whether a vendor’s component supply and service commitments hold up if the rule tightens, not what’s stamped on the finished unit.
